jQuery根据id清除html
时间: 2024-08-01 18:01:03 浏览: 38
jQuery是一个非常流行的JavaScript库,它简化了DOM操作。如果你想使用jQuery来清除HTML元素,特别是根据ID选择的元素,可以使用`remove()`或`empty()`方法。
1. 使用`remove()`方法:
```javascript
$("#yourId").remove();
```
这会移除匹配给定ID的元素及其所有后代节点。
2. 使用`empty()`方法:
```javascript
$("#yourId").empty();
```
这会清空匹配元素内的所有内容,保留元素本身。
例如,如果你有一个id为"example"的div需要清除其内容:
```javascript
$("#example").empty(); // 或 $("#example").remove();
```
相关问题
jquery 点击按钮清除输入框里的值
可以使用 jQuery 的 val() 方法来清除输入框里的值。首先,给按钮绑定一个点击事件,然后在事件处理函数中使用 val() 方法将输入框的值设置为空字符串即可。
HTML 代码:
```html
<input type="text" id="myInput">
<button id="clearBtn">清除</button>
```
jQuery 代码:
```javascript
$('#clearBtn').click(function() {
$('#myInput').val('');
});
```
这样当用户点击按钮时,输入框里的值就会被清空。
Jquery 保留整数部分,去除小数的方法
可以使用JavaScript中的Math.floor()函数来将小数向下取整为整数。而在Jquery中,可以通过对数值进行取整运算来保留整数部分,去除小数部分。例如:
```javascript
var num = 10.245;
var integerPart = Math.floor(num);
console.log(integerPart); // 输出 10
```
在这个例子中,Math.floor()函数会将num向下取整为整数,然后将结果赋值给integerPart。这样就可以得到只保留整数部分的结果了。
另外,如果你需要对一个Jquery对象中的数值进行取整操作,可以使用Jquery中的val()方法获取数值,然后进行取整操作。例如:
```html
<input type="text" id="num-input" value="10.245">
```
```javascript
var numInput = $('#num-input');
var numValue = parseFloat(numInput.val()); // 先使用parseFloat()函数获取数值
var integerPart = Math.floor(numValue); // 对数值进行取整操作
console.log(integerPart); // 输出 10
```
在这个例子中,先使用Jquery的val()方法获取输入框中的数值,然后使用parseFloat()函数将字符串转换为数值。接着对数值进行取整操作,最终得到只保留整数部分的结果。